引言C语言作为一种经典的编程语言,广泛应用于系统软件、嵌入式系统、操作系统等领域。学习C语言,不仅可以提升编程技能,还能深入理解计算机的工作原理。本文将通过截图的方式,详细介绍C语言编程的入门技巧,帮...
C语言作为一种经典的编程语言,广泛应用于系统软件、嵌入式系统、操作系统等领域。学习C语言,不仅可以提升编程技能,还能深入理解计算机的工作原理。本文将通过截图的方式,详细介绍C语言编程的入门技巧,帮助初学者轻松入门。
首先,我们需要搭建一个C语言编程环境。以下以Windows系统为例,介绍如何配置C语言开发环境。
选择一款合适的编译器,如Dev-C++、Code::Blocks等。以Dev-C++为例,下载并安装。
在系统属性中,选择“高级系统设置”,点击“环境变量”按钮,在“系统变量”中添加以下变量:
变量名:CPLUSPLUS
变量值:编译器安装路径,如C:\Dev-Cpp\MinGW\bin
变量名:Path
变量值:在变量值中添加编译器安装路径,如C:\Dev-Cpp\MinGW\bin
下面是C语言的第一个程序,输出“Hello, World!”。
#include
int main() { printf("Hello, World!\n"); return 0;
} 将上述代码保存为hello.c,在命令行中进入文件所在目录,输入以下命令编译:
gcc hello.c -o hello编译成功后,运行程序:
./hello控制台将输出“Hello, World!”。
C语言中的变量用于存储数据。以下是一些常见的数据类型和变量声明示例:
int a; // 整型变量
float b; // 单精度浮点型变量
double c; // 双精度浮点型变量
char d; // 字符型变量C语言中的控制语句用于控制程序流程。以下是一些常用的控制语句:
if (条件) { // 条件为真时执行的代码
} else { // 条件为假时执行的代码
}for循环for (初始化; 条件; 更新) { // 循环体
}while循环while (条件) { // 循环体
}do-while循环do { // 循环体
} while (条件);C语言中的函数用于封装代码,提高代码复用性。以下是一个简单的函数示例:
#include
void printMessage() { printf("Hello, World!\n");
}
int main() { printMessage(); return 0;
} C语言支持文件操作,以下是一些常见的文件操作示例:
#include
int main() { FILE *fp; char ch; // 打开文件 fp = fopen("example.txt", "r"); if (fp == NULL) { printf("Error opening file.\n"); return 1; } // 读取文件内容 while ((ch = fgetc(fp)) != EOF) { putchar(ch); } // 关闭文件 fclose(fp); return 0;
} 通过本文的介绍,相信你已经对C语言编程有了初步的了解。希望这些截图和示例能够帮助你轻松入门C语言编程。在实际编程过程中,多动手实践,不断积累经验,你将能够掌握更多的编程技巧。